सामान्य चूक:
Learners sometimes confuse "friar" with "fryer". "Friar" is a religious man, while "fryer" is a pan or machine used for cooking food in hot oil. Learners may also use "monk" and "friar" as exact synonyms; in many contexts this is understandable, but a friar usually works among ordinary people, while a monk usually lives in a closed religious community.

व्याख्या
A man in a special Christian religious group, who has taken vows and usually works and lives among ordinary people.
A man who belongs to a Roman Catholic or related Christian religious order, living under vows and typically working and preaching among the general public rather than in a closed monastery.
